My Buying Guides on Bariatric Toilet Seat Riser

Why I Look for a Bariatric Toilet Seat Riser

When I shop for a bariatric toilet seat riser, my main goal is comfort, safety, and stability. I want a product that makes sitting and standing easier without feeling wobbly or unsafe. Since this is a support item, I pay close attention to weight capacity, fit, and how securely it attaches to the toilet.

Weight Capacity Matters Most to Me

The first thing I check is the maximum weight limit. I never want to choose a riser that is too close to my body weight, because I prefer extra support and peace of mind. I look for a model that clearly states a higher bariatric weight rating and feels sturdy enough for daily use.

I Make Sure It Fits My Toilet

Not every toilet seat riser fits every toilet, so I always measure before buying. I check the bowl shape, seat length, and width to make sure the riser will sit properly. A poor fit can make the riser uncomfortable or unsafe, so this step is very important to me.

Stability and Secure Installation Are Essential

I want a riser that stays firmly in place. When I install one, I look for locking mechanisms, non-slip edges, or brackets that help keep it secure. If it shifts while I’m sitting down or standing up, I know it is not the right choice for me.

Comfort Is a Big Priority for Me

I prefer a seat riser with a smooth, comfortable surface and enough width to support me properly. If I use it often, comfort becomes just as important as strength. I also like a design that does not pinch, press, or create pressure points.

I Consider Height Carefully

The riser height can make a big difference in how easy it is for me to use the toilet. If it is too low, it may not help enough. If it is too high, it may feel awkward. I choose a height that reduces strain on my knees and hips while still feeling natural to use.

Material Quality and Durability Matter to Me

I look for strong, easy-to-clean materials that can handle everyday use. A bariatric toilet seat riser should be durable and resistant to cracking or wear. I prefer materials that feel solid and can be cleaned quickly with regular bathroom products.

I Check for Easy Cleaning

Hygiene is important to me, so I want a riser that is simple to wipe down and maintain. Smooth surfaces and fewer hard-to-reach areas make cleaning much easier. I avoid designs that seem likely to trap dirt or moisture.

Armrests and Extra Support Can Help

If I need extra assistance, I look for a riser with armrests or side support handles. These features can make sitting and standing much easier and safer for me. I especially value them if balance is a concern.

I Pay Attention to Installation and Removal

I prefer a model that is easy to install without complicated tools. At the same time, I want it to stay secure once it is in place. If I need to remove it for cleaning, I like a design that does not take too much effort.
